Alphons Joseph Kannanthanam is an Indian civil servant, advocate, and politician. He is the former Union Minister of State for Culture and Tourism. He is a member of the Bharatiya Janata Party. He is the second BJP Central Minister from Kerala and has also served as Commissioner of the Delhi Development Authority.

Wiki/Biography

Alphons Joseph Kannanthanam was born on Saturday, 8 August 1953 (age 70 years; as of 2023) in Manimala, Kottayam District, Kerala. His zodiac sign is Leo. Alphons pursued his early education at Malayalam-medium village schools near Manimala. In 1977, he pursued a master’s degree in Economics at North Eastern Hill University, Shillong. While serving as the Commissioner of the Delhi Development Authority, he did his LLB in 1996 at Delhi University.

Career

Indian Administrative Service 

Alphons Kannanthanam joined the Indian Administrative Service in 1979 and served for 27 years. He has been in many different positions during his reign as a civil servant but he became a popular name when he was given the title of “Demolition Man”.He is known as the Demolition man because, during his stint with the DDA, he recovered over 1,100 acres of DDA land that had been valued well over Rs 10,000 crore. According to an estimate, he demolished more than 14,000 illegal buildings.

Politics

Alphons Kannanthanam began his political journey in 2006, by becoming an independent MLA backed by the CPI(M) in Kerala. On 24 March 2011, he joined the BJP. In 2017, he was appointed the Minister of State in the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ology, and Minister State (independent charge)) of the Ministry of Tourism. On 9 November 2017, Alphons was elected unopposed as a Rajya Sabha member from Rajasthan. Alphons Kannanthanam contested as a National Democratic Alliance candidate from the Ernakulam constituency for the 2019 Indian general election and came third.

Kerala Bar Council suspends Alphons Kannanthanam

In November 2010, Alphons Kannanthanam was suspended by The Bar Council of Kerala (BCK), after they found him guilty of professional misconduct. He was suspended for 6 months. The committee said,

He had converted his proprietorship business to a private limited company and became the chairman of the company, from which he was receiving Rs 25,000 a month as well as 15 per cent of the company’s revenues. He should be debarred but should also be given an opportunity to stop his business within six months and continue practising as a lawyer if he desired to do so”
